Informational content and information structures: a pluralist approach

Invited tutorial given at the ILCLI International Workshop on Logic and Philosophy of Knowledge, Communication and Action

Abstract. The tutorial connects two notions of information: the inverse relationship principle which relates informational content to the exclusion of possibilities, and information-structures based on a partial ordering on states of information. Jointly, these allow the formulation of several distinct precise notions of content-individuation.
